The 2024 edition of the Giro d'Italia has solidified Rome's status as a major hub for sports and tourism. The race's culmination in the Eternal City has sparked enthusiasm among thousands of fans and generated significant economic impact. Mayor Roberto Gualtieri and Grand Events Councilor Alessandro Onorato aim to sustain this success over time, aspiring to make Rome a permanent fixture on the Giro, akin to Paris in the Tour de France. "Rome is primed for major events," declared Gualtieri. "The synergy between our city and the Giro d'Italia is extraordinary and triumphant. Citizens have shown immense passion for the race, crowding the streets to cheer on the champions. We want the Giro's conclusion always to be in Rome because it's its natural endpoint."
Onorato underscored the importance of sports as an economic growth tool. "High-profile sports events attract tourists worldwide and significantly boost our businesses," he affirmed. "The 2024 Giro d'Italia edition is evidence: between March and April, hotel room occupancy rose by 81.34% compared to 2023." In addition to the Giro d'Italia, Rome recently hosted the Tennis Internationals and the Piazza di Siena equestrian competition. These events have enhanced the city's international reputation and reaffirmed its penchant for grand occasions. "Rome is no longer the city of 'no'," concluded Onorato. "It's the capital of major sports and cultural events, an international metropolis capable of hosting world-class manifestations."
